This book, edited by Rishabha Malviya, Dhanalekshmi Unnikrishnan, and Priyanshi Goyal, explores the application of laser therapy in healthcare. It delves into the principles of laser physics and their implications for medical treatments, highlighting advances in diagnosis and therapy. The text covers a wide range of applications, including laser surgery in various medical fields, management of genitourinary syndrome, early cancer detection, and treatment of conditions like sepsis and diabetic macular edema. It also examines the use of laser technology in dentistry and wound healing. Aimed at healthcare professionals, researchers, and students, the book emphasizes safe and effective clinical practices in laser therapy. |
